A recruitment agency is seeking an experienced Team Administrator to support their Governance Team on a full-time basis in London. The role involves organizing meetings, managing expenses, and providing comprehensive administrative support.

Candidates should possess strong organizational skills, IT literacy, and proficiency in Microsoft 365. Previous experience in a fast-paced environment is essential. This position is initially for 12 months, with immediate interviews and the possibility of extension.
